Sony Ericsson Xperia Pro “Bravia” Office Smartphone

Dressed in slider design, Sony Ericsson unveiled a new office smartphone, Xperia Pro. The smartphone is having chick finish of frame surface and enables to display and write your office documents through the pre-loaded Office Suite Pro.

Compared to Nokia E7, Xperia Pro is more tiny in screen size,3.7-inch with three suitable operation buttons on the bottom. Like always, its touchscreen is powered by mobile Bravia engine. More it’s also scratch-resistant.

Bact to office’s things, its optimized slide-out full Qwerty keyboard serves you nicely to text your documents. Coupled with Smart Keyboard, it’s easily for you to send messages or update your status on Facebook or your others favorite social networks.

In addition, the Xperia Pro features Android Gingerbeard OS, up to 320MB phone memory, a microSD memory card up to 32GB, an 1GHz Qualcoom Snapdragon MSM8255 processor, WiFi, Bluetooth, a 8.1MP camera with Exmore R CMOS sensor, and battery that support up to 7 hours talk time. Thanks to HDMI support, you can connect the Pro to your Sony KDL-CX520 Bravia TV.

Packed in 120x57x13.5mm and 140gr weight, Sony Ericsson Xperia Pro smartphone is expected to hit selected market globally in end of Q2 2011. There is no information about its pricing.
